Without ratios, it’s 16th note quadruplet, 16th note quituplet, and 32nd note quadruplet from the bottom up in that 3 staff example.
With ratios, it’s 4:6, 5:6, and 4:6 with 16th beams on the first two and 32nd beams on the last.
This is read as “4 16ths in the time of 6 16ths, 5 16ths in the time of 6 16ths, and 4 32nds in the time of 6 32nds”.
in 6/8 the measure-long quadruplet would have 1 beam.
In 6/16 that doubles.

As I stated above, I believe that
A)
in simple time, tuplets increase the regular value until the next regular value is reached.
B)
In compound time, tuplets reduce the regular value until the next regular value is reached.
As you pointed out, it is not always a matter of "surplus," but sometimes also of "deficit."
